Bay Springs was not able to break out of their rough patch on Friday as the team picked up their third straight loss. Their tough 16-1 defeat to the Stringer Red Devils might stick with them for a while. The result was an unpleasant reminder to Bay Springs of the 15-0 loss they experienced in the pair's previous head-to-head fixture back in April of 2023.
For Stringer's part, they got a massive performance out of Ava Jefcoat, who went 1-for-3 with a home run, three RBI, and two runs. Another player making a difference was Kayleigh Douglas, who scored three runs and stole two bases while going 1-for-4.
Bay Springs' defeat dropped their record down to 2-8. As for Stringer, the victory (which was their eighth in a row) raised their record to 15-4-1.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Bay Springs will challenge Scott Central at 6:30 p.m. on Monday. As for Stringer, they are on the road again on Monday to play Sumrall at 9:09 a.m. Both teams will come into the matchup having just posted big wins, so someone is set to suffer a big change in fortunes.
